ABSTRACT
 |
Objective: To investigate the
influence of bizhongxiao decoction(BZXD) which is a Traditional Chinese medicine
for RA including, on the plasma TNF-α and IL-1β in rats with CⅡ-induced
arthritis (CIA) and explore the protective mechanism of BZXD in the treatment of
rheumatoid arthritis .
Methods: 75 SD rats were divided into four groups randomly. Normal
control group (n=5) not be treated any more. The CIA rat was established by
subcutaneous injection with bovine Ⅱ collagen(BⅡC) and complete Freund,s
adjuvant(CFA) after 7d breeding. The CIA rats were divided into the CIA
group(n=16)、BZXD group (n=29) treated with BZXD and the MTX group(n=25) treated
with methotrexate. All rats were killed after various intervals(25,30,35,40,or
45d). At the end of each time interval, we collected the blood of each rat. To
detect TNF-αand IL-1βin plasma with radio-immunity kit. Results: BⅡC and CFA can
be used to copying CIA model. The incidence of arthritis was 88%. The plasma
TNF-αand IL-1βlevels of CIA group, BZXD group and MTX group were notably higher
than those of normal control group(p<0.05), moreover, the CIA group was higher
than those of the MTX group and BZXD group at various interval (p<0.01).
TNF-αand IL-1βrose step by step in CIA group but decreased in BZXD group and MTX
group gradually. Moreover, in BZXD group were lower than those in MTX group
(p<0.05). Conclusion: TNF-αand IL-1βplay a very important role in the formation
and development of RA. BZXD can notably decrease the plasma TNF-αand
IL-1βlevels, which was better than MTX.
Key words: bizhongxiao decotion, methotrexate, arthritis, rheumatoid, TNF-α,
IL-1β
Rheumatoid arthritis (RA) is particular with chronic and symmetric arthritis
which get along with joint damage and matrix erosion. But its mechanism has not
been clear. The recent research has demonstrated that TNF - α and IL-1β play key
role in the disease of RA and made progress with matrix erosion. To explore the
mechanism of the RA and the function of BZXD ,we make the collagen-induced
arthritis rat and treated with BZXD, then detect the level of TNF-αand IL-1βin
plasma at various interval

MATERIALS
AND METHODS
 |
Material:
Of 75 SD rats(age: 45-50 days old, weight 150±30g), 37 female and 38 male of rats
were selected for experiment which were purchased from XiangYa medical college
experimental center, central southern university. Bovine ⅡCollagen was purchased
from the company of Sigma. Freund's complete adjuvant (FCA) was bought from the
company of Gbica. TNF- α and IL-1βradio-immunity kits were bought from the East
Asia immunity center of Beijing.
Methods:
Dividing experimental animals:
Seventy-five SD rats are divided into 4 groups randomly:①Normal control group
(N=5);②CIA group(N=16); ③MTX group(N=25); ④BZXD group(N=29)。
Rat model established: [1]
Grinded collagen type-Ⅱwith FCA, and then injecting the compound 100 μl into the
rat tail skin for each one. For enhancing the immunity effect, injecting again
according to the above method after 21 days.
Treatment:
7 days after immunity, rats in BZXD group and MTX group were treated
respectively which in BZXD group was treated with BZXD 10ml.kg-1twice every day
(the usage equal to 3 times of 70 kg person) and in MTX group was treated with
MTX 2.7mg.kg - lonce every week (the usage equal to 3 times of 70 kg person). Rats
in normal control group not be treated any more.
Arthritis symptom evaluation: [2]
Arthritis index which is according to the red and swollen degree in joint was
adopted to evaluate symptom. 0 cents: no arthritis; 1 cent: light swelling or
few red spot;2 cents: middle degree swelling in joint;3 cents: joint swollen
badly and can't sustain themselves. The joint index more high, the joint symptom
more serious.
Method of obtaining tissues:
Rats in normal group are killed at 25d. Those rats in CIA group、BZXD group and
MTX group were killed at 25d、30d、35d、40d、45d respectively. After using
anticoagulantand and separating plasma with EDTA, these specimens were protected
in -20℃ for use. Above process go according to the kits introduction.
Statistical analysis:
All the data were analysised by using statistical software package (spss11.0 )
and were manifested by mean and standard deviation (
±s). Different groups were
compared with analysis of variance and t-test.
|
RESULTS
 |
The general condition:
CIA rats eat less and weigh lighter than those in the other three groups.
Moreover, they have dry hair. After the first time immunity, the partial rats
have light swelling and red spot at joint. Ten days later, the arthritis get
more bad. After enhancing immunity at 21d, the symptom get serious more and
more. CIA rats swellen in ankles and toes symmetry. But in the BZXD group and
the MTX group ,those rats have joint swelling and inflammation alleviates
gradually from 30d while the CIA group have the highest arthritis index.
The result of the arthritis index:
There were no differences among these three groups before 14d.Following the time
advancing, the arthritis index increase gradually. The symptom of those rats in
BZXD group and MTX group rise to the peak at 21d and 25d respectively, which was
lower than those in CIA group. To 30d, the arthritis index decline.

DISCUSSIONS
|
The RA held chronic and symmetry arthritis as primary expression which based on
the synovitis. Its cause and mechanism are unclear yet. With the cell molecular
biology and the immunology developing and the RA animal model established, these
information can help to find mechanism such as cytokines、TH1/ TH2 cell
balanced、cell apoptosis、sex hormone、 proto-oncogene which are of great
importance to the outbreak of RA. Among numerous cytokines, people have
confirmed that the IL-1, TNF- α played a key role in arthritis progression
[3 , 4]. TNF- α is an important regular factor in
inflammation and immunity response, which can stimulate the synoviocyte and
cartilage cells to synthesize the PGE2 and collagenase causing synovium and
cartilage destruction in joint. TNF- α can stimulate itself synthesization as
well as those of IL-1、IL-6、 IL-8. It is one of the most important factors in the
cytokine network.. IL-1 includes IL-1α and IL-1β which is mainly secreted by
macrophage 、the endothelial cells and lymphoid cells. It might to induce a
series of inflammation response including fever, synthesization of the acute
period protein and influence of the local cartilage and the matrix metabolism.
There was a study showed that TNF- α blocker is valid in the early arthritis,
but the treatment of the anti- IL-1 can prevent the arthritis from developing
continuously and the cartilage destruction[5
, 6].In rabbit arthritis model, using adenovirus carrier to load the
IL-1 solube receptor into knee joint can reduce the cartilage erosion and the
leucocyte infiltration[7]. IL-13 have also
anti-inflammation activity because of suppressing IL-1β and TNF- α expression[8].
Wim van den Berg[9] pointed that TNF- α caused
early joint swelling in RA and IL-1β combining with the immune complex lead to
the cartilage erosion. TNF blockage was effective in the early period, and
following anti-IL-1 treatment was effective on the blockage of arthritis and
joint destruction ,he said. At the same time, IL-1 affect TNF- α mutually which
aggravate the disease. TNF- α which can induce IL-1 production is important at
the onset of RA. And based on this view, he pointed that it is necessary to
block IL-1 and TNF- α in the treatment of RA . Observing in this experiment, the
joint swelling and inflammation was obvious after established the mold 25d. TNF-
α and IL-1β rise remarkably with the disease progress which indicated these two
cytokines play the key role in RA pathologic process. Following TNF- α and IL-1β
declined, the symptom of the red and swelling alleviated in joint after treated
with BZXD and MTX. Which coincided with the above report.
The BZXD is a Traditional Chinese medicine for active period RA which can
promote blood circulation and remove blood stasis、clear away heat and toxic
materials、induce diuresis to reduce edema and dispel pathogenic mind and remove
obstruction in the channels. BZXD can relieve symptom such as morning stiffness、
joint ache、joint swelling and so on in the treatment with active period RA .All
these role of BZXD were better than those of MTX. At the same time, the BZXD
still has the anti- immunity and regulating the sub-cluster in T cells which
resemble with the MTX[10].In CIA model, it can
suppress the expression of VEGF in synovium [11]and
reduce the local inflammation and the pannus formation. BZXD can reduce IL-1β
level and relieve the arthritis which might result from regulating the immunity
function、suppressing the TNF- α expression or combining with the TNF- α receptor
and then interrupt the cytokine net. whether the BZXD can block the cartilage
destruction or not, there still has a lot of work to do.
